How much do on call wah customer service representative j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for on call wah customer service representative in the United States is $18.05,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.90 and $19.23 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an On Call Wah Customer Service Representative?

An On Call Wah (Work-at-Home) Customer Service Representative is a remote worker who provides customer support services as needed, rather than on a fixed schedule. They handle customer inquiries, resolve issues, and offer product or service information, often via phone, email, or chat. Being 'on call' means they are available to work during periods of high demand or when regular staff are unavailable. This role offers flexibility, making it ideal for those seeking variable hours or supplemental income. Employers typically provide training and equipment, but strong communication skills and a reliable internet connection are essential.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an On Call Work-at-Home (WAH) Customer Service Representative, and why are they important?

To thrive as an On Call WAH Customer Service Representative, you need strong verbal commun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) software, call center telephony systems, and basic computer proficiency are essential. Exceptional patience, active listening, and the ability to remain calm under pressure help representatives excel in handling diverse customer inquiries remotely. These skills and qualities ensure effective, empathetic service and high customer satisfaction in a remote, often fast-paced environment.

What are some unique challenges faced by On Call Wah Customer Service Representatives, and how can they prepare for them?

On Call Wah Customer Service Representatives often face the challenge of handling unpredictable work hours and a high volume of inquiries, sometimes during peak demand periods. Being on-call requires flexibility and the ability to quickly adapt to a variety of customer needs, often resolving issues without prior notice. To succeed, representatives should develop strong time management skills, maintain a well-organized workspace, and become familiar with common customer concerns and company procedures. Building rapport with colleagues and supervisors can also help ensure seamless handovers and support during busy shifts.

What is the difference between On Call Wah Customer Service Representative vs Call Center Customer Service Representative?

AspectOn Call Wah Customer Service RepresentativeCall Center Customer Service Representative
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skills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skills
Work EnvironmentPrimarily remote or on-call; flexible hoursOffice or call center setting; scheduled shifts
Industry UsageUsed in healthcare, utility services, and on-demand supportCommon across various industries including retail, telecom, and tech
Job FocusHandling urgent, on-demand customer inquiriesManaging high-volume customer calls and support

Both roles involve customer support with similar credentials, but On Call Wah Customer Service Representatives typically work remotely and handle urgent, on-demand inquiries, whereas Call Center Customer Service Representatives work in a structured environment managing high call volumes. The choice depends on your preferred work setting and type of customer interaction.

Description

Location Requirement:  Candidates must currently reside within the McAllen, Mission, Pharr, Edinburg, Harlingen or Brownsville, Texas areas in order to be considered for this position.  

Summary: Axon River is seeking Customer Service Representatives to join the team! CSRs will provide inbound or outbound call support to our various clients. CSRs are expected to provide exceptional customer service while following protocols and guidelines. They will use various web-based systems to answer customer inquiries. Responsibilities may include: 

Essential Duties:

Answer customer inquiries with professional courtesy, giving exceptional customer service to each customer, based on client specific instruction.

Document each customer’s inquiry information into a database.

Verify customer’s information, making corrections and updates as needed.

Actively listen to recognize opportunities to offer additional information to callers, ensuring the caller and client has received the best customer service experience possible.

Follow-up with callers as necessary.

Use statistical contact center data to make improvements to performance.

Outbound calling for surveying to obtain client specific information.

Shift and Schedule adherence

Requirements

High School Diploma or GED

Knowledge of how to operate a computer, use internet search engines, and navigate multiple windows/tabs

Prior call center or customer service experience highly desired

Effective verbal and written communication skills

Ability to multi-task, operate a computer, and utilize specialized telephone systems

Ability to multi-task

Ability to sit for extended periods of time

Candidates must meet the following requirements to work from home:

Must have the ability to provide a non-cellular high speed internet service such as Fiber, DSL, or cable modems for a home office.

Must be able to meet the minimum internet speed requirements for specific program

Hotspots, satellite and wireless internet service is NOT allowed for this role.

Willing to use webcam or video features during training and production

Conditions of Employment:

Successful completion of pre-hire testing

Successful completion of background check is required for this position.

Must be able to provide proof of education such as high school diploma, GED, or college transcripts/diploma

Must be able to provide proof two valid, in date forms of ID
